Please follow the manufacturer's assembly instructions in detail to
ensure the safety features of the cot are not compromised.
Ensure the cot is placed at a reasonable distance from curtains, blinds,
heaters and power points. Keep all medications, string, elastic, small toys or
small items, such as money, out of reach from any position in the cot.
Assembly
Care must be taken when attaching sides.Ensure all crews are 100% tight
before use,but do not over tighten screws as this can cause damage to the
cot. Once assembled lift furniture into place,do not drag.
Care and Maintenance
Regularly check all screws for tightness or damage that could render the cot
unsafe. To clean,use a damp cloth, avoiding the use of detergents or
abrasives.
RECOMMENDED MATTRESS SIZE
This cot has been manufactured for use with a mattress which measures
690 mm wide by 1300 mm long and 100 mm in thickness. The width and
length are specified because it is important that gaps between the mattress
and the sides and ends of the cot will not exceed 40mm when the mattress
is pushed to one exceed 40mm when the mattressis pushed to one side or
end, and 20 mm.
When the mattress is centered in the cot. This is to minimize the risk of a
child's limb becoming caught in the gap. The thickness of the mattress has
been specified to ensure that the depth of the cot is greater than 500mm
with the mattress base in the lower position to minimize the risk of a child
climbing or falling out of the cot.
Maress Position
WARNING: TO PREVENT FALLS, THE MATTRESS BASE
OF THIS COT SHOULD BE ADJUSTED TO THE LOWEST
POSITION BEFORE THE CHILD CAN SIT UP.
